Geographic position of Wichita

Wichita is located in the Northern Hemisphere and the Western Hemisphere. Its coordinates are 37.6922° N, 97.3375° W.

  • Distance from the Equator:
    about 4,196 km
  • Distance from the North Pole:
    about 5,823 km
  • Distance from the South Pole:
    about 14,215 km
  • Distance from the Prime Meridian:
    about 8,574 km west

Wichita lies in the temperate latitude zone. This latitude affects daylight length, seasonal variation and how local solar time compares with standard clock time.

Daylight saving time changes in Wichita

Wichita uses the IANA time zone identifier America/Chicago. The current local offset is UTC-5 / CDT.

March 8 Sunday
2026

Previous change: Daylight saving time started

  • The offset changed from UTC-6 / CST to UTC-5 / CDT.
  • The clock was moved forward from 02:00 to 03:00 local time.
November 1 Sunday
2026

Next change: Standard time starts

  • The offset will change from UTC-5 / CDT to UTC-6 / CST.
  • The clock will be moved back from 02:00 to 01:00 local time.
